Method for detecting single board fault

A single-board failure and detection method technology, which is applied in the direction of error detection/correction, instrumentation, electrical digital data processing, etc., can solve the problems of software watchdog method, such as large limitation, low reliability, and complicated fault judgment, and achieve detection The effect of reliable results, direct detection, and simple fault determination process

Inactive Publication Date: 2006-06-14
ZTE CORP
View PDF0 Cites 16 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] The purpose of the present invention is to overcome the shortcomings of the current indirect detection method, which are complex and low in reliability, and the software watchdog method is relatively limited, and propose a method that can directly detect software and hardware faults on a single board in operation.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for detecting single board fault

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0015] The present invention will be further described in detail below in conjunction with the accompanying drawings and embodiments.

[0016] figure 1 It is a flowchart of the detection method proposed by the present invention. Such as figure 1 As shown, the single board fault detection method proposed by the present invention comprises the following steps:

[0017] Step 1. Set a heartbeat signal register on the board, and power on the board to run;

[0018] Step 2. Alternately write specific heartbeat values ​​into the heartbeat signal register with a certain cycle;

[0019] Step 3, FPGA reads the value in the heartbeat signal register, and outputs the read heartbeat signal to the detection bus;

[0020] Step 4: Determine whether the software is running normally. Here you can judge whether the software is running normally by whether the dog feeding cycle exceeds the specified time. If yes, continue, otherwise, write the abnormal heartbeat value into the heartbeat signa...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

This invention discloses a method for testing errors of a single board including: 1, setting a heartbeat signal register on the board and operating on it on line, 2, writing specific heartbeat values alternatively in the register in a period of time, 3, FPGA fetches the heartbeat values and outputs the heartbeat signals to a test bus, 4, judging if the software works normally, if so, the work is continued, otherwise, it writes in abnormal heartbeat value or stops writing the value in the register to execute step 7, 5, carrying out writing and reading operation to the register in a main service chip and comparing if the values are consistent to judge if said chip works normally, 6, if so, the work is continued, otherwise, it writes the abnormal value or stops writing the value in the register, 7, judging if the signal is all right, if so, it returns to step 2, otherwise, the error of the single board is output.

Description

technical field [0001] The invention relates to a real-time fault detection method when a single board is running, belonging to the field of communication control. Background technique [0002] For equipment boards with high reliability requirements, it is necessary to respond quickly to board failures, manually replace the faulty board or activate the automatic protection switching mechanism to switch the services of the faulty board to the protection board. At this time, the fault detection of the single board is particularly important. Single-board fault detection refers to checking the running status of the software and hardware of the single-board through some method or external tools to determine whether the single-board is faulty. Currently, the most commonly used method for single-board fault detection is the indirect detection method. The indirect detection method mainly monitors the services carried by the single board, and checks whether the single board is fault...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F11/00H04L12/26
Inventor 张建伟余正华
Owner ZTE C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products